THE 8TH MAN IS ANNOUNCED.

Former Ring Of Honor Tag Team champion. Former IWC Heavyweight champion. Former PWU Tag Team champion. One half of the Havana Pitbulls and member of the infamous Rottweilers stable. Master of the Dragon Sleeper and one of the hardest-hitting, most brutal competitors on the indy wrestling scene.

RICKY REYES is the 8th and final wrestler to be entered into the tournament to crown a new Union Heavyweight champion. Reyes, who made his Union debut at October's STATE OF SHOCK event, impressed Union officials enough to earn the final spot in the tournament. And Reyes will not only have a shot at the title on November 3rd, he'll also have a shot at revenge.

We can now also announce the first of the four opening round tournament match-ups will see Ricky Reyes in a rematch against "The King of Iron City Hardcore", STERLING JAMES KEENAN. Can Ricky rebound from October's disappointment and advance in the tournament or will Keenan make it 2-and-0 against Reyes on his way to championship gold?

UNION WORKERS FIGHT THEIR WAY TO EVEN MORE GOLD

Two of the eight men entered into November's Union Heavyweight title tournament prepared for November 3rd by winning gold over the weekend. First, STERLING JAMES KEENAN defeated former ECW star ULF HERMAN for the 1PW Heavyweight title in a cage match in Doncaster, England. Keenan has blossomed into a top star in England since being recruited by then-1PW Head of Talent Relations ANTHONY KINGDOM JAMES two years ago.

And on this side of the Atlantic Ocean, PEPPER PARKS deafeated EDDIE OSBOURNE and DEREK WYLDE for the PWA Niagara championship. Osbourne, who went into this 3-way elimination match as the champion, has been suffering through a streak of bad luck of late, including two losses in the Union. He'll need to regain his winning form to take advantage of his spot in the Union championship tournament: an early gift from Anthony Kingdom James.
